What Does a a Truck Insurance Agent in Tuscaloosa Cost?
Truck insurance in Alabama typically costs between 8000 and 15000 per year for a single truck depending on driving record cargo type and coverage limits. Factors like hauling hazardous materials or operating in urban areas like Tuscaloosa can raise premiums. This is general information and not insurance advice.

Frequently Asked Questions
What are the minimum insurance requirements for trucks in Alabama?
Alabama requires commercial trucks to carry at least 25/50/25 liability coverage. This means 25000 for injury per person 50000 total per accident and 25000 for property damage. Higher limits are often needed for interstate hauling.

Does Alabama require uninsured motorist coverage for trucks?
Alabama does not require uninsured motorist coverage but insurers must offer it. You can reject it in writing. Many trucking companies choose to carry it for extra protection on Alabama roads.
